How to prepare for a job interview at Flexzo Ai
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your medical knowledge and the specific requirements of the locum GP role. Familiarise yourself with common conditions and treatments relevant to the practices in Sunderland, as well as any recent guidelines or changes in healthcare.
✨Flexibility is Key
Since this role offers flexible sessions, be prepared to discuss your availability openly. Highlight how your schedule can adapt to the needs of the practice, showing that you're ready to jump in whenever required.
✨Communication Skills Matter
As a locum GP, you'll need to communicate effectively with both patients and staff. Prepare examples of how you've successfully managed patient interactions, whether face-to-face or over the phone, to demonstrate your strong communication skills.
✨Ask Questions
Don’t hesitate to ask questions during the interview. Inquire about the practice's culture, the types of cases you might encounter, and how they handle locum support. This shows your genuine interest and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
